Skip to content

Commit

Permalink
commit by Octane (#118)
Browse files Browse the repository at this point in the history
* Release 1.2.1 (#85)

* fix: unsubrscribe data provider on component updates

* Release 1.2.1

Co-authored-by: Norbert Nader <nnader@amazon.com>

* fix: resolves #83 (#87)

* fix: resolves #83

* Update index.ts

Co-authored-by: Norbert Nader <nnader@amazon.com>

* feat: improve documentation (#90)

* Run tests on pull request (#91)

* Update reference to code name (#86)

AWS-UI internal code name is mentioned in the readme.

Co-authored-by: Norbert Nader <Norbert.Nader@gmail.com>

* feat: update synchro charts to 3.1.0, update docs (#92)

* feat: Improve documentation formatting (#93)

* feat: Improve resource explorer docs (#95)

* Update README.md (#94)

* feat: support fetchMostRecentBeforeStart (#79)

* Update documentation & make react-components easier to use (#98)

* Utilize lock file in CI (#99)

* build(deps): bump async from 2.6.3 to 2.6.4 (#100)

Bumps [async](https://github.com/caolan/async) from 2.6.3 to 2.6.4.
- [Release notes](https://github.com/caolan/async/releases)
- [Changelog](https://github.com/caolan/async/blob/v2.6.4/CHANGELOG.md)
- [Commits](caolan/async@v2.6.3...v2.6.4)

---
updated-dependencies:
- dependency-name: async
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* feat: support auto-assigning colors for certain components (#96)

* feat: support auto-assigning colors for certain components

* Update package.json

* Update cypress to v9, added stricted linting, fixed linting warnings and errors (#104)

* Add stylelint and enforce via global package.json (#106)

* use most recent synchro-charts version, 4.0.1 (#111)

* build(deps): bump eventsource from 1.1.0 to 1.1.1 (#116)

Bumps [eventsource](https://github.com/EventSource/eventsource) from 1.1.0 to 1.1.1.
- [Release notes](https://github.com/EventSource/eventsource/releases)
- [Changelog](https://github.com/EventSource/eventsource/blob/master/HISTORY.md)
- [Commits](EventSource/eventsource@v1.1.0...v1.1.1)

---
updated-dependencies:
- dependency-name: eventsource
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* feat: expand children in resource explorer (#115)

* feat: expand children in resource explorer

* fix typo

* Fix asset module cache

* Add logic for fetching hierarchies

* Add tests

* Improve insert

* Fix linting

Co-authored-by: Norbert Nader <nnader@amazon.com>

* Update README.md (#121)

Fix test runner status badge

* Bump minor version (#120)

* specify react types package version to be 17 (#134)

Co-authored-by: Xinyi <xinyxu@amazon.com>

* build(deps): bump parse-url from 6.0.0 to 6.0.2 (#142)

Bumps [parse-url](https://github.com/IonicaBizau/parse-url) from 6.0.0 to 6.0.2.
- [Release notes](https://github.com/IonicaBizau/parse-url/releases)
- [Commits](https://github.com/IonicaBizau/parse-url/commits)

---
updated-dependencies:
- dependency-name: parse-url
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* Fix: Development Quick Start Docs/Scripts (#148)

* add yarn bootstrap script to replace lerna bootstrap

* specify supported node and yarn engines

* simplify development docs and update build steps

Co-authored-by: Thomas Juranek <thjurane@amazon.com>

* build(deps): bump moment from 2.29.2 to 2.29.4 (#149)

Bumps [moment](https://github.com/moment/moment) from 2.29.2 to 2.29.4.
- [Release notes](https://github.com/moment/moment/releases)
- [Changelog](https://github.com/moment/moment/blob/develop/CHANGELOG.md)
- [Commits](moment/moment@2.29.2...2.29.4)

---
updated-dependencies:
- dependency-name: moment
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* fix: update @testing-library/react to use create root (#151)

Co-authored-by: Norbert Nader <Norbert.Nader@gmail.com>

* feat(props): adapt props for synchro-charts (#133)

* feat(props): adapt props for synchro-charts

* add testing for new props

* fix(tests): cleanup tests from devwork

* Update changelog

* update tests to wait for intercepts

Co-authored-by: Norbert Nader <Norbert.Nader@gmail.com>

* feat: batch API for historical, aggregated, and latest value data (#137)

* fix: resolve float decimal precision issue on round() function. (#160)

* fix: update @testing-library/react to use create root

* fix: resolve float decimal precision issue on round() function.

* Simplify round() function. Remove managing the negative sign separately.

Co-authored-by: Norbert Nader <Norbert.Nader@gmail.com>

* sync changes with private repo for common files (#150)

* sync changes with private repo for common files

* Revert "fix: update @testing-library/react to use create root (#151)"

This reverts commit 960f53f.

Co-authored-by: Xinyi <xinyxu@amazon.com>

* Update npm packages repository (#161)

* build(deps): bump terser from 4.8.0 to 4.8.1 (#168)

Bumps [terser](https://github.com/terser/terser) from 4.8.0 to 4.8.1.
- [Release notes](https://github.com/terser/terser/releases)
- [Changelog](https://github.com/terser/terser/blob/master/CHANGELOG.md)
- [Commits](https://github.com/terser/terser/commits)

---
updated-dependencies:
- dependency-name: terser
  dependency-type: indirect
...

Signed-off-by: dependabot[bot] <support@github.com>

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>

* docs: Fix KPI docs and explain behavior of querying timer-series data when resolution is omitted

* bump synchro-charts/core version from v5 to v6 (#199)

Co-authored-by: Thomas Juranek <thjurane@amazon.com>

* docs: Add coding guidelines

* organize coding guidelines into sections and reword items (#212)

sentance casing on headings

Co-authored-by: Thomas Juranek <thjurane@amazon.com>

* feat(core)!: Refactor time series data module to  remove unused functionality. Add meta field to data stream.

BREAKING CHANGE: Refactored export from `@iot-app-kit/core` IoTAppKitDataModule to be named TimeSeriesDataModule, and removed the concept of multiple data sources per time series data module

* feat(core): Support caching of dataType, name and other fields describing dataStreams

* feat(core,source-iotsitewise)!: Change time series data modules getRequestsFromQueries to be async

Fix various eslint errors on existing code

* chore: remove unecessary template section

* build: npm workspaces (#231)

* feat(core): Add meta field to requestInfos in TimeSeriesDataModule

* build: npm publish with npm workspaces (#233)

* docs: add documentation for publishing new packages (#236)

* docs: add documentation around data sources and time series data

* feat(core): Add viewportManager to orchestrate viewport syncing within groups

* docs(core): Add documentation for viewportManager; export viewportManager from pkg

* feat: set up table package and add createTableItems method (#124)

- config typescript & rollup
- config jest
- config eslint
- add unit tests for createTableItems method
- updated .eslintrc.js at project root level

fix: update tsconfig path in eslintrc for Table package.

- remove unused variables.

fix: add tests for dataFilters.ts

- update descriptions for tests in createTableItems.spec.ts
- add one test case for getting data point from aggregated datastream

fix: remove unnecessary describe block

fix: use object to replace CellItem class
- add createCellItem function
- add unit tests for createCellItem
- rename SC_DataStream to SynchroChartsDataStream for better consistency

fix: remove unused import
- update createCellItem tests.

* feat(table): create new Table component based on AWSUI Table component (#129)

feat: add helper functions for

- iconUtils.tsx - copied from synchro-charts with changes.
- iconUtils.spec.ts - copied from synchro-charts with changes:
-- add one test cases, that color are provided, compared with the original.
- spinner.tsx - copied from synchro-charts with adjustments for React
- spinner.spec.tsx - copied from synchro-charts with adjustments for React

feat: add the main table component

fix: remove generic types for TableProps

fix: add size to loading spinner

fix: remove unnecessary TS compiler options

update a few things based on comments from PR.

Fix: remove full file eslint disable. Switch to minimal eslint disable.

* fix(table): fix an issue when key in columnDefinition doesn't exist in TableItems (#146)

fix: remove unused variables.

* feat!(component): replace table component in @iot-app-kit/components (#147)

* feat: Replace iot-table with new version.

* Update autogenerated types

* fix import

* another fix for import

* another fix for import

* Remove unused property for Iot.

* Fix a typo

* Code cleanups.

* Code cleanups.

* update type of `ColumnDefinition.formatter`

also added a few use cases in testing-ground.tsx

* update type of `ColumnDefinition.formatter`

also added a few use cases in testing-ground.tsx

* Update asset/property IDs and table examples.

* update: add formatter to filterOptions

Property filtering options now has the same displayed value as table.

* update formatPropertyFilterOptions function to better handle error & loading states.

* update test examples for table component.

* Disable Customized formatter for property filter options.

* update test cases after disabled formatter for filter options

* Remove unused dependency.

* a few bug fixes
- Split sorting and propertyFiltering
- Remove formatting on property filtering options.

* UI adjustment - center icon and string vertically.

* Update styles and unit tests

* Remove unused imports and statements.

* Reformat css file

* Restore testing ground

* chore(table): Merge changes from mainline and other changes: (#169)

* docs(table): update docs and add README.md (#165)

* Update docs. Add README.md for new table component.

* fix(table): add missing brackets. (#183)

* docs(table): update docs / major version bump for breaking changes.(#213)

* feat(table): support messageOverrides (#211)

* chore(table): add missing tests (#215)
- render correct data based on different viewports
- render spinner when a datastream is loading
- render error icon and message when a datastream in error state
- render icon and apply styles when it breaches thresholds

* docs(table): update docs / remove unnecessary jest configuration (#217)

* fix(components): move message merge to componentWillRender()

- clean git history and update doc
- removed unused method in `iot-react-table.tsx`

* build: add table to workspace

- updated docs
- export `dataFilters` from core and removed duplications from table.
- update npm-publish.yml
- update table styles
- iot-table: watch messageOverrides for changes

* docs(table): revert version bumps and doc changes.

* chore: update changelogs & docs / major version bumps to 2.0.0

* fix(components): import missing CSS style sheets.

Co-authored-by: Norbert Nader <Norbert.Nader@gmail.com>
Co-authored-by: Norbert Nader <nnader@amazon.com>
Co-authored-by: db <77755322+diehbria@users.noreply.github.com>
Co-authored-by: Mitchell Lee <mitch@evildev.net>
Co-authored-by: Bowei Han <boweih@amazon.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Xinyi Xu <sheilaxxy@gmail.com>
Co-authored-by: Xinyi <xinyxu@amazon.com>
Co-authored-by: Thomas Juranek <thomas@juranek.com>
Co-authored-by: Thomas Juranek <thjurane@amazon.com>
Co-authored-by: Xiao(Bill) Li <limxiao@amazon.com>
Co-authored-by: jmbuss <107281089+jmbuss@users.noreply.github.com>
Co-authored-by: Brian Diehr <diehbria@amazon.com>
  • Loading branch information
14 people committed Sep 22, 2022
1 parent 4186d5d commit 882c79f
Show file tree
Hide file tree
Showing 2 changed files with 16 additions and 34 deletions.
45 changes: 15 additions & 30 deletions package-lock.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 1 addition & 4 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-108,9 +108,6 @@
},
"resolutions": {
"@types/react": "^17.0.2",
"@types/react-dom": "^17.0.2",
"postprocessing": "6.23.2",
"@types/three": "0.131.0",
"three": "0.131.0"
"@types/react-dom": "^17.0.2"
}
}

0 comments on commit 882c79f

Please sign in to comment.